Nano-Ion Battery Energy Storage: Separating Hype from Reality

Nano-ion battery technology once promised to revolutionize energy storage with faster charging, higher density, and longer lifespans. But after a decade of development, questions arise: Has it failed to deliver? Let''s cut through the noise and examine its real-world performance.

Where Nano-Ion Batteries Are Making Waves

  • Renewable Energy Integration: Solar farms in California now use nano-ion systems to store excess daytime energy for night use
  • Electric Vehicles: Prototype EVs achieve 500+ mile ranges using modified nano-ion architectures
  • Industrial Backup: Factories in Germany report 40% faster response times compared to traditional lithium-ion

Challenges Holding Back Adoption

While promising, three key hurdles remain:

  1. Manufacturing costs still 35% higher than mature lithium-ion tech
  2. Scalability issues in electrodes larger than 100Ah capacity
  3. Recycling infrastructure lagging behind production growth

Why Industries Still Bet on Nano-Ion

Recent advances address earlier limitations:

  • Graphene-enhanced anodes boost conductivity by 300%
  • Self-healing electrolytes reduce degradation by 60%
  • Modular designs enable easier capacity upgrades

FAQ: Nano-Ion Battery Energy Storage

Q: Can existing factories switch to nano-ion production? A: Partial retrofitting is possible, but new deposition systems are required for nano-structured electrodes.

Q: How do safety profiles compare to lithium-ion? A: Early tests show 45% lower thermal runaway risk due to stable ceramic electrolytes.
